预览加载中,请您耐心等待几秒...
1/3
2/3
3/3

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

车用微控制器运算和译码部件的设计与验证的开题报告 一、选题背景 随着汽车电子技术的不断发展,微控制器在汽车电子系统中的应用越来越广泛。微控制器作为一种具有集成化、可编程、可靠性高等优点的芯片,已经成为了现代汽车电子系统中不可或缺的一部分,应用于发动机控制、ABS制动系统、电子稳定控制系统等各个方面。 微控制器运算和译码部件是微控制器中的核心部分,能够实现各种控制算法和命令的执行。因此,对于这一部分的设计和验证显得尤为重要。为了提高汽车电子系统的可靠性和安全性,设计和验证车用微控制器运算和译码部件的手段和方法具有重要的理论和实践意义。 二、选题内容 本课题分为两个主要内容: (1)车用微控制器运算和译码部件的设计 本课题将会对基于ARM架构的车用微控制器运算和译码部件进行设计,并完成硬件电路设计和软件程序代码编写。设计内容包括微控制器运算、译码模块、中断模块、时钟模块等,并使用VerilogHDL语言进行描述和模拟,最终实现硬件电路和软件程序的相互协调和运作。 (2)车用微控制器运算和译码部件的验证 通过对设计的车用微控制器运算和译码部件进行仿真测试和硬件验证,检测其能否正常地执行各种控制算法和命令,保证其性能和可靠性达到设计要求。其中,仿真测试将集中在功能测试、时序测试、电气特性测试等方面,硬件验证将通过实际的测量和测试来验证仿真结果的正确性和实用性。 三、研究目标 本课题将致力于达到以下研究目标: (1)实现基于ARM架构的车用微控制器运算和译码部件的设计; (2)完成硬件电路设计和VerilogHDL语言描述和模拟; (3)完成车用微控制器运算和译码部件的软件程序编写和调试; (4)完成仿真测试和硬件验证,保证设计要求的性能和可靠性。 四、研究方法 为了实现本课题的研究目标,将采用以下研究方法: (1)文献调研:对车用微控制器运算和译码部件的相关文献进行全面综合调研,了解目前的研究现状和进展。 (2)软件设计:采用KeiluVision5集成开发环境进行软件程序的编写与调试,实现车用微控制器运算和译码部件的程序代码。 (3)硬件设计:采用AltiumDesigner软件进行车用微控制器运算和译码部件的电路设计,完成原理图画板、元器件库以及布线等工作。 (4)仿真测试和硬件验证:采用ModelSim软件进行车用微控制器运算和译码部件的仿真测试,并利用万用表、示波器等测试设备进行硬件验证,保证设计要求的性能和可靠性。 五、预期结果 本课题将获得以下预期结果: (1)基于ARM架构的车用微控制器运算和译码部件的设计方案; (2)车用微控制器运算和译码部件的VerilogHDL语言模拟结果和软件程序代码; (3)车用微控制器运算和译码部件的仿真测试报告和硬件验证结果; (4)关于车用微控制器运算和译码部件的相关科研论文或社会实践报告。